집 >데이터 베이스 >MySQL 튜토리얼 >mysql을 사용하여 고유 일련번호 생성
데이터베이스가 테이블로 나누어져 있거나 프로그램 자체에 고유 ID가 필요한 경우 고유 ID를 생성하는 솔루션이 필요합니다.
시간과 특정 특성을 결합하여 고유한 ID를 생성하는 프로그램을 작성할 수도 있습니다. 이 요구 사항을 달성하기 위해 데이터베이스에서 ID 자동 증가 기능을 사용하는 것도 고려할 수 있습니다.
먼저 ID를 생성하기 위해 특별히 테이블을 만듭니다. 여기서 id 필드는 기본 키이고 replacement_key 필드는 고유 키입니다.
CREATE TABLE `ticket` ( `id` bigint(20) unsigned NOT NULL auto_increment, `replace_key` char(1) NOT NULL default '', PRIMARY KEY (`id`), UNIQUE KEY `replace_key` (`replace_key`) )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=10001;
ID를 생성해야 할 때마다 바꾸기 문을 사용하여 새 레코드를 생성하고 이전 레코드를 바꾼 다음 ID를 반환하세요.
REPLACE INTO `ticket` (`replace_key`) VALUES ('a'); SELECT LAST_INSERT_ID();
추천 mysql 비디오 튜토리얼, 주소: https://www.php.cn/course/list/51.html
위 내용은 mysql을 사용하여 고유 일련번호 생성의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!